Description
Management of Obesity: A Comprehensive Manual for Physicians presents obesity as a multifactorial, chronic, and relapsing disease that contributes to a wide range of cardiometabolic disorders. Designed to bridge the gap between evidence and practice, the book translates current scientific understanding into practical, patient-centered clinical strategies. It offers holistic coverage of obesity—from molecular mechanisms and pathophysiology to prevention and management—with special emphasis on the Indian and South-Asian context. The manual encompasses the full therapeutic spectrum, including lifestyle and behavioral interventions, pharmacotherapy, bariatric and metabolic surgery, and emerging modalities such as digital therapeutics and gut microbiome modulation. Real-world case studies, comparative tables, and concise algorithms make it a valuable clinical resource. Above all, the book highlights that obesity care extends beyond weight reduction, focusing instead on restoring health, functionality, and dignity through empathy and sustained physician–patient partnership.
